Attassa.OAuthLinkedIn.authorizeToken C# (CSharp) Method

authorizeToken() public method

Authorize the token by showing the dialog
public authorizeToken ( ) : String
return String
        public String authorizeToken()
        {
            if (string.IsNullOrEmpty(Token))
            {
                Exception e = new Exception("The request token is not set");
                throw e;
            }

            //AuthorizeWindow aw = new AuthorizeWindow(this);
            LoginForm aw = new LoginForm(this);
            aw.ShowDialog();
            Token = aw.Token;
            Verifier = aw.Verifier;
            if (!string.IsNullOrEmpty(Verifier))
                return Token;
            else
                return null;
        }

Usage Example

Example #1
0
        private void goNavigateButton_Click(object sender, RoutedEventArgs e)
        {
            try
            {
                String requestToken = _oauth.getRequestToken();
                txtOutput.Text += "\n" + "Received request token: " + requestToken;

                _oauth.authorizeToken();
                txtOutput.Text += "\n" + "Token was authorized: " + _oauth.Token + " with verifier: " + _oauth.Verifier;
                String accessToken = _oauth.getAccessToken();
                txtOutput.Text += "\n" + "Access token was received: " + _oauth.Token;
            }
            catch (Exception exp)
            {
                txtOutput.Text += "\nException: " + exp.Message;
            }
        }
All Usage Examples Of Attassa.OAuthLinkedIn::authorizeToken